Today, there’s literally nothing you can buy with a single penny – and you can’t do much else with it either. Vending machines don’t accept them, and neither do most parking meters. Even automatic toll booths won’t take them – except in Illinois, the home state of President Abraham Lincoln, whose face adorns the coin.

The correct answer is 1: Illustration-example.

Illustrations and examples are introduced by the transition phrases such as "for instance" and "for example". Some other linking words for giving examples are "to illustrate", "namely", and "such as". These linking words do not necessarily have to be at the beginning of the sentence.
